python 如何画出KD数简单的KNN算法在为每个数据点预测类别时都需要遍历整个训练数据集来求解距离,这样的做法在训练数据集特别大的时候并不高效,一种改进的方法就是使用kd树来存储训练数据集,这样可以使KNN分类器更高效。KD树的主要思想跟二叉树类似,我们先来回忆一2023-02-26Python100
图遍历算法之最短路径Dijkstra算法最短路径问题是图论研究中一个经典算法问题,旨在寻找图中两节点或单个节点到其他节点之间的最短路径。根据问题的不同,算法的具体形式包括: 常用的最短路径算法包括:Dijkstra算法,A算法,Bellman-Ford算法,SPFA算法2023-02-26Python170
C语言二分法查找#include <stdio.h>不用math头文件void main(){int high = 9,low = 0,m,k,a[10]={1,2,3,4,5,6,7,8,9,10}hing和low赋初值2023-02-26Python140
C语言二叉树的深度指什么?怎么求?从根节点到叶子结点一次经过的结点形成树的一条路径,最长路径的长度为树的深度。根节点的深度为1。解体思路:1.如果根节点为空,则深度为0,返回0,递归的出口。2.如果根节点不为空,那么深度至少为1,然后我们求他们左右子树的深度,3.比2023-02-26Python130
C语言二分法查找#include <stdio.h>不用math头文件void main(){int high = 9,low = 0,m,k,a[10]={1,2,3,4,5,6,7,8,9,10}hing和low赋初值2023-02-26Python310
怎么使用python来爬取网页上的表格信息稍微说一下背景,当时我想研究蛋白质与小分子的复合物在空间三维结构上的一些规律,首先得有数据啊,数据从哪里来?就是从一个涵盖所有已经解析三维结构的蛋白质-小分子复合物的数据库里面下载。这时候,手动一个个去下显然是不可取的,我们需要写个脚本,能2023-02-26Python140
GO语言商业案例(六):PayPal创建 PayPal 的目的是使金融服务民主化,并使个人和企业能够加入并在全球经济中蓬勃发展。这项工作的核心是 PayPal 的支付平台,该平台使用专有技术和第三方技术的组合来高效、安全地促进全球数百万商家和消费者之间的交易。随着支付平台变得2023-02-26Python70
GO语言商业案例(六):PayPal创建 PayPal 的目的是使金融服务民主化,并使个人和企业能够加入并在全球经济中蓬勃发展。这项工作的核心是 PayPal 的支付平台,该平台使用专有技术和第三方技术的组合来高效、安全地促进全球数百万商家和消费者之间的交易。随着支付平台变得2023-02-26Python170
c语言数据结构:怎么建立一个二叉树?只要将一个二叉树用“括号表示法”表示出来,然后,用链式存储结构将其各个结点存储就可以了,也就是输入一个二叉树。最后,用中序遍历输出!typedef struct node { ElemType data struct node2023-02-26Python200
java如何讲文件转化成流再单向生成基于流(Stream)的解决流是单向的有方向性的描述信息流的对象,InputStream是输入流的接口,对程序来说是入,是读,可以从文件读,缓存区读,网络节点读等等.写入文件,对程序来说是出,是写,就是FileOutputStream,可以2023-02-26Python110
c语言数据结构单链表(头插入法)head=(LNode*)malloc(sizeof(LNode))这一句不要,没啥用处,除非你head指向的节点也就是第一个节点的data不需要数据head->next=NULL这里修改为head=NULL让head先指向NU2023-02-26Python160
R语言中的tree和rpart有什么区别rpart包的处理方式:首先对所有自变量和所有分割点进行评估,最佳的选择是使分割后组内的数据更为“一致”(pure)。这里的“一致”是指组内数据的因变量取值变异较小。rpart包对这种“一致”性的默认度量是Gini值。确定停止划分的参数有很2023-02-26Python130
c语言如何实现一棵二叉树的遍历今天我也遇到这道题了,经过我的研究,我觉得应该是如下的解答:首先画出该树 :如下图左边所示。然后根据树的二叉链表表示法表示存储结构如图右边所示:注意这里的指针域为左边表示第一个孩子*firstchild,右边表示兄弟*nextsibli2023-02-26Python330
go是什么编程语言?主要应用于哪些方面?Go语言由Google公司开发,并于2009年开源,相比JavaPythonC等语言,Go尤其擅长并发编程,性能堪比C语言,开发效率肩比Python,被誉为“21世纪的C语言”。Go语言在云计算、大数据、微服务、高并发领域应用应用非常广2023-02-26Python150
用C语言实现对单链表的基本操作#include <stdio.h>#include <stdlib.h>typedef int DataTypetypedef struct node {DataType members2023-02-26Python120
python-xml怎么安装啊pip install lxml python2.7.9 自带pip安装工具。 看下面图片,图中显示本人电脑已经安装好了。1.直接copy下载的模块文件中已经有了模块的文件,有些模块只有一个文件,比如较早版本的BeautifulSoup,有2023-02-26Python110
图像分割算法python难不难是一种常用的图像处理方法,可分为传统方法和深度学习的方法。深度学习的方法比如:mask rcnn这类实例分割模型,效果比传统的图像分割方法要好的多,所以目前图像分割领域都是用深度学习来做的。但是深度学习也有它的缺点,模型大、推理速度慢、可解2023-02-26Python130
java解析xml的几种方式哪种最好?(1)DOM解析DOM是html和xml的应用程序接口(API),以层次结构(类似于树型)来组织节点和信息片段,映射XML文档的结构,允许获取(2)SAX(Simple API for XML)解析流模型中的"推"2023-02-26Python150
Python中的树你知道吗?树与二叉树在了解二叉树之前,我们要先了解树的一些概念,方便我们对二叉树的理解。什么是树?树(英语:tree)是一种抽象数据类型(ADT)或是实作这种抽象数据类型的数据结构,用来模拟具有树状结构性质的数据集合。它是由n(n&g2023-02-26Python190
golang使用Nsq1. 介绍 最近在研究一些消息中间件,常用的MQ如RabbitMQ,ActiveMQ,Kafka等。NSQ是一个基于Go语言的分布式实时消息平台,它基于MIT开源协议发布,由bitly公司开源出来的一款简单易用的消息中间件。 官方和2023-02-26Python140